Q135941: Write Protection Error Message with DriveSpace 3

The information in this article applies to:

- Microsoft Windows 95 
- Microsoft Plus! for Windows 95 
-------------------------------------------------------------------------------

SYMPTOMS
========

On a computer with a write-protected, mounted, compressed removable drive, you
may receive a write error message on a blue screen from the compression driver.

CAUSE
=====

This error occurs because the compression driver does not have write access to
the host drive.

RESOLUTION
==========

Remove the write protection from the removable drive and try the operation
again.
